The orthogonal equivalent to Google Earth

Is Stellarium, the program that lets you scan and zoom and spin and take control of the night sky, from anywhere on earth, at any point in the past or future.

It is free and open source, and very cool.

Also, if I haven’t mentioned it before, DesktopEarth is also very cool, although not open source.  But it is free.
